In a recent turn of events at the Morinë border crossing, authorities apprehended a 28-year-old man caught red-handed attempting to smuggle a weapon into Albania. The young man, whose intentions remain under investigation, faced immediate arrest as border security took swift action to maintain safety at the checkpoint.
